Here’s a crazy-cool steampunk watch:

steampunk_watch

  • 1,352 components working together in masterful horological precision
  • driven by a 450 link chain and nickel silver drums.
  • $275,000 for the base model
  • $400,00 to get it studded in platinum and diamonds.
  • From Cabestan Watches.

It seems like something you’d want to keep under glass, rather than wear. I myself want something more durable.
